Recently, BC Housing’s Director of Indigenous Relations and Board members worked collaboratively on creating a more in-depth strategy to enhance the organization’s Indigenous relations. This includes working with Indigenous communities to develop relationships and partnerships with the Canadian Housing Mortgage Corporation (CMHC) and the Department of Indigenous Services Canada (ISC) and developing relationships with organizations such as the First Nations Health Authority. 52 3.1.2.2 Funding Opportunities BC Housing supports Indigenous Nations, communities, and organizations through various funding opportunities. This includes the Indigenous Housing Fund, a housing program and proposal process that expanded support to on-reserve housing projects in 2018 and represents a historical moment with BC being the first province in Canada to provincially fund “on- Nation” 53 housing. 54 An overview of all funding opportunities is provided in Table 4 below.

53 In recent years, BC Housing has started to use the term “on-Nation” internally (with staff and Board) to describe on-reserve and in-community contexts. The term “on-Nation” was adopted by the Ministry of Housing as an alternative to “on-reserve.” 54 PAR Internal Assessment Report 2019.
